This role will involve working closely with individuals living with various disabilities. The Support Coordinator (Level 2) role enhances participants' ability to connect with informal, community, and funded supports, ensuring effective plan utilisation.
Key responsibilities include:
- Building skills to understand and use NDIS plans.
- Coordinating a mix of supports to boost capacity in maintaining relationships.
- Managing service delivery tasks.
- Facilitating independence and community inclusion.
- Helping participants achieve their personal goals.
This role involves working closely with individuals to navigate and maximise their support systems.
